You should think about the space you’re working in and the surface you’re working on. You also need to think about the size of the backdrop you need. But you can also get vinyl or plastic backdrops that are strong and reliable, even after many photoshoots. ![]() Laminated paper is durable enough and easy to clean. That means you have to think about the material the backdrop is made of. You need a backdrop that can withstand the spills and thrills of food photography time and time again. While it is affordable, paper is too easily damaged. Some photographers use colored card or paper, but that isn’t good practice in the long run. Of course, you want a robust and reusable backdrop.
